UK-based Oriole Networks secures €20.2M in funding
London-based Oriole Networks, a developer of AI optimisation expertise, has secured a further $22M (roughly €20.27M) ...
Read moreLondon-based Oriole Networks, a developer of AI optimisation expertise, has secured a further $22M (roughly €20.27M) ...
Read moreScan.com Crew | Picture credit score: Scan.comLondon-based Scan.com, a healthcare referral and digital platform for reserving ...
Read morePeter Fleming/iStock Editorial by way of Getty Photos Expensive readers/followers, On this article, I am going ...
Read more Copyright © 2022 - Newshare 24.
Newshare 24 is not responsible for the content of external sites.